KZDC 1250 has applied to move its daytime transmit site to the current night diplex with KTSA. Day power will be 290 watts from the same directional array used at night. Night power remains at 920 watts.
This obviously marks the end of the current separate day site, which ran 25kw.
There had been speculation that the KZDC license would be turned in, but it would appear the station will be kept going a while longer.
